数据库a模式什么意思
-
数据库的模式是指数据库中存储数据的结构和组织方式。具体来说,数据库模式定义了数据库中的表、字段、关系、约束等元素的结构和属性。数据库模式可以分为三个层次:外模式、概念模式和内模式。
-
外模式:外模式也称为用户模式,是数据库的最高层次。它定义了用户能够看到和访问的数据的逻辑结构和组织方式。每个用户可以有不同的外模式,根据用户的需求和权限,可以定义不同的视图和访问权限。
-
概念模式:概念模式是数据库的中间层,它定义了数据库的全局逻辑结构和组织方式。概念模式描述了数据库中所有表、字段、关系和约束的逻辑结构,但不涉及具体的物理存储细节。概念模式是数据库设计的核心,它反映了用户对数据的整体认识和抽象。
-
内模式:内模式也称为物理模式,是数据库的最低层次。它定义了数据库在存储介质上的实际存储方式和组织结构。内模式描述了数据在磁盘或其他存储介质上的物理存储方式,包括文件的组织方式、索引的结构和存储的压缩方式等。
数据库模式的作用是提供对数据库的逻辑和物理结构的抽象,使用户能够方便地访问和操作数据库中的数据。通过定义数据库模式,可以实现数据的组织和管理,保证数据的一致性和完整性,并提供高效的数据访问和查询功能。此外,数据库模式还可以为数据库的安全性和性能优化提供基础。
1年前 -
-
数据库的模式(schema)是指数据库中存储的数据的逻辑结构和组织方式。它定义了数据库中的表、视图、索引、存储过程等对象的名称、结构和关系。数据库的模式可以理解为数据库的“蓝图”,它描述了数据库的整体结构和组织方式。
在数据库中,可以有多个模式存在,每个模式可以包含多个表和其他对象。不同的模式可以用来划分不同的数据集合,以便更好地管理和组织数据。
数据库模式可以分为两种类型:用户定义模式和系统定义模式。
-
用户定义模式:用户定义模式是指用户对数据库进行的定义和设计。它是根据用户的需求和业务逻辑来设计的,反映了用户对数据的理解和组织方式。用户定义模式定义了用户可以访问和操作的数据对象,如表、视图、存储过程等。
-
系统定义模式:系统定义模式是指数据库管理系统(DBMS)内部使用的模式。它定义了数据库中存储数据的物理结构和存储方式。系统定义模式不直接对用户可见,它包含了数据库的内部细节,如数据文件的组织方式、索引的结构等。
总而言之,数据库的模式是指数据库中存储数据的逻辑结构和组织方式。它定义了数据库中的表、视图、索引、存储过程等对象的名称、结构和关系。数据库的模式可以分为用户定义模式和系统定义模式。用户定义模式是根据用户的需求和业务逻辑来设计的,反映了用户对数据的理解和组织方式;而系统定义模式是数据库管理系统内部使用的模式,定义了数据库的物理结构和存储方式。
1年前 -
-
数据库的模式(Schema)指的是数据库中的结构,包括表、视图、索引等对象的定义。数据库模式定义了数据在数据库中的组织方式和关系,决定了数据的存储方式和访问权限。
数据库模式描述了数据库中的实体、属性和实体之间的关系。它定义了表的结构,包括表的名称、列的名称、列的数据类型、列的约束等。模式还可以定义视图、索引、触发器、存储过程、函数等数据库对象。
数据库模式有两种类型:物理模式和逻辑模式。
-
物理模式(Physical Schema):物理模式描述了数据在计算机存储介质上的存储方式。它定义了表的存储结构、索引的创建方式、数据的存储位置等。物理模式决定了数据在磁盘上的存储方式,包括文件的组织方式、数据块的大小、索引的类型等。
-
逻辑模式(Logical Schema):逻辑模式描述了数据在用户视图中的组织方式。它定义了表之间的关系、实体之间的关系等。逻辑模式是从用户的角度来定义数据库,它隐藏了物理存储细节,用户只需要关注数据的逻辑结构和操作方式。
在数据库设计中,通常先设计逻辑模式,然后再根据逻辑模式设计物理模式。逻辑模式主要由数据库设计人员来定义,而物理模式则由数据库管理员来定义。
总结起来,数据库模式是数据库的结构定义,包括表、视图、索引等对象的定义。它描述了数据在数据库中的组织方式和关系,决定了数据的存储方式和访问权限。数据库模式有物理模式和逻辑模式两种类型,分别描述了数据在存储介质上的存储方式和数据在用户视图中的组织方式。
1年前 -